XLoD Global - New York is the world’s leading event for 550+ executives managing non-financial risks including Heads of 1st Line Risk & Control, Chief Risk Officers, Chief Compliance Officers, and Heads of Internal Audit at the world’s largest banks.

 

The event is attended by industry leaders in charge of managing non-financial risk and compliance at the world’s systemically important financial institutions and their regulators. Participant attend to debate the latest emerging risks, regulatory expectations and best practice across topics including regulatory risk, market abuse, employee mis-conduct and their firms culture as well as leveraging technology in automation (RPA), data analytics and ML / AI.
